Atlas 5 launches GPS satellite
Posted: Wed, Nov 4, 2015, 8:14 PM ET (0114 GMT)
Atlas 5 launch of GPS 2F-11 (ULA) An Atlas 5 rocket successfully launched a GPS navigation satellite Saturday after a one-day delay. The Atlas 5 401 lifted off at 12:13 pm EDT (1613 GMT) Saturday and deployed the GPS 2F-11 satellite a little more than three hours later. The launch, previously scheduled for Friday, was delayed 24 hours because of a pad issue. The satellite is the next to last in the Block 2F series of GPS spacecraft built by Boeing. The launch was also the third Atlas 5 launch in the month of October, including two from Florida and one from California.
